The Complexity of Sludge Storage
Sludge generated in wastewater treatment plants, industrial effluent management, and biogas systems is chemically aggressive and mechanically abrasive. It typically contains organic and inorganic solids, variable water content, corrosive chemicals, and often odorous gases like hydrogen sulfide. This environment creates a perfect storm that makes conventional concrete or carbon steel tanks prone to corrosion, structural failure, and contamination if not properly engineered.
Key storage challenges include:
- Chemical Corrosion: Wide pH range and sulfide-rich environments degrade unprotected steel quickly.
- Abrasion: Solid particles in sludge cause wear on tank surfaces and structural components.
- Leak Prevention: Impervious containment systems are essential to avoid soil and groundwater contamination.
- Gas Containment: Sealing is critical to prevent escape of hazardous gases and odors.
- Variable Volume & Temperature: Tanks must accommodate fluctuating sludge volumes and temperature changes.
- Maintenance & Longevity: Minimizing downtime through robust design and materials is essential.
Glass-Fused-to-Steel Technology: A Superior Solution
Center Enamel’s GFS sludge tanks are manufactured by firing powdered glass onto steel panels at temperatures between 820°C and 930°C. This causes the glass to chemically fuse to the steel surface, creating an inert, monolithic coating that resists chemical attack and physical abrasion.
Key attributes of GFS tanks include:
- Corrosion Resistance: The glass enamel is highly resistant to acids, alkalis, salts, solvents, and sulfides typically found in sludge.
- Hardness & Wear Resistance: With a Mohs hardness of 6, the coating withstands abrasion from solids in sludge.
- Leak-Proof Sealing: The modular bolted design includes specialized gaskets and sealants ensuring liquid and gas tightness.
- Smooth, Non-Adhesive Surface: Prevents sludge buildup, facilitating cleaning and maintenance.
- pH Range: Standard coatings resist pH 3 to 11; special coatings expand the range to 1 to 14
Technical Specifications of Center Enamel GFS Sludge Storage Tanks
| Specification | Details |
| Steel Plate Thickness | 3mm to 12mm (customized per tank dimensions) |
| Glass Enamel Coating Thickness | 0.25 to 0.45 mm on both sides |
| pH Resistance Range | Standard: 3–11, Optional: 1–14 |
| Adhesion Strength | 3450 N/cm² |
| Mohs Hardness | 6.0 |
| Service Life | 30+ years |
| Leak Test Voltage | >1500 V (holiday test) |
| Color Options | Black Blue, Grey Olive, Forest Green, Desert Tan, etc. |

Maintenance and Longevity
The GFS slurry tanks demand minimal maintenance due to their glass-coated surfaces. Periodic inspections focus on seals, mechanical fittings, and structural integrity. Minor damages can be repaired or panels replaced without complete deconstruction, maximizing operational uptime.
